AI陪聊软件如何提升多用户并发处理能力
随着互联网技术的飞速发展,人工智能(AI)已经逐渐渗透到我们生活的方方面面。其中,AI陪聊软件作为一种新型的社交工具,深受广大用户的喜爱。然而,在用户数量激增的背景下,如何提升多用户并发处理能力,成为了AI陪聊软件发展的重要课题。本文将通过一个真实案例,探讨AI陪聊软件在提升多用户并发处理能力方面的探索与实践。
一、AI陪聊软件发展背景
近年来,随着社交网络的普及,人们对于即时通讯工具的需求日益增长。然而,传统的社交软件在处理多用户并发时,往往会出现卡顿、延迟等问题,影响用户体验。为了解决这一痛点,AI陪聊软件应运而生。这类软件通过人工智能技术,为用户提供24小时在线、实时响应的陪伴服务。
二、多用户并发处理能力的重要性
AI陪聊软件的核心价值在于为用户提供优质、高效的陪伴体验。然而,在用户数量激增的情况下,如何保证软件的稳定性和流畅性,成为了关键问题。以下是多用户并发处理能力的重要性:
提高用户体验:在多用户并发环境下,软件能够快速响应用户请求,降低延迟和卡顿现象,从而提升用户体验。
扩大市场占有率:具备优秀多用户并发处理能力的AI陪聊软件,能够更好地满足用户需求,从而在激烈的市场竞争中脱颖而出。
降低运营成本:通过优化多用户并发处理能力,可以减少服务器资源消耗,降低运营成本。
三、案例分享:某AI陪聊软件的多用户并发处理实践
某知名AI陪聊软件在发展过程中,面临着多用户并发处理能力的挑战。以下是该软件在提升多用户并发处理能力方面的实践:
- 技术选型
(1)采用高性能服务器:为了应对多用户并发需求,该软件选择使用高性能服务器,确保软件在高负载下仍能保持稳定运行。
(2)分布式架构:采用分布式架构,将服务器资源进行合理分配,实现负载均衡,提高系统整体性能。
(3)数据库优化:对数据库进行优化,提高查询速度和并发处理能力。
- 代码优化
(1)异步编程:在代码层面,采用异步编程技术,提高系统响应速度。
(2)内存优化:对内存使用进行优化,降低内存泄漏风险。
- 网络优化
(1)CDN加速:通过CDN加速,降低用户访问延迟。
(2)TCP优化:对TCP协议进行优化,提高网络传输效率。
- 持续监控与优化
(1)实时监控:对软件性能进行实时监控,及时发现并解决潜在问题。
(2)定期优化:根据用户反馈和系统运行数据,定期对软件进行优化。
四、总结
AI陪聊软件在提升多用户并发处理能力方面,需要从技术、代码、网络等多个维度进行优化。通过优化服务器性能、采用分布式架构、异步编程等技术手段,可以有效提高软件的多用户并发处理能力,为用户提供优质、高效的陪伴体验。在未来的发展中,AI陪聊软件将继续探索技术创新,以满足用户日益增长的需求。
猜你喜欢:AI语音聊天